bella29 · 10/02/2009 22:05

My top two suggestions would be Simple Solution from PAH or Odour Eliminator from your vets.

Have you tried these?

bella29 · 10/02/2009 22:06

Also, it may have soaked into the wood so rather than scrubbing you may need to let the odour remover soak in too, iyswim.
